Under the hood of the standard 2022 Toyota Prius is a 1.8-Liter 4-Cylinder Aluminum DOHC 16-Valve hybrid engine with VVT-i. The 2022 Prius can be driven in EV, Eco, or Power modes and can generate a net total of 121 horsepower at 90 kW, and 105 lb-ft of torque. An Electronically controlled Continuously Variable Transmission (ECVT) system sends engine power to the front wheels of the 2022 Toyota Prius. However, an optional all-wheel drive is also available. When maintained properly and serviced timely, the standard trim of the 2022 Toyota Prius can offer a fuel economy rating of 58 MPG within city limits, 53 MPG on freeways, and 56 MPG combined.
